Our client is a well funded MGA with 400 employees and an office in Central London. They are looking for an experienced Underwriter to join their Commercial team. This individual will be involved in day-to-day execution but also help to refine and improve processes, strategy and products. They will be tasked with managing broker relationships.
The company has ambitious growth plans for 2025 and beyond and has a very good reputation as does the MD this role reports into.
You will have 5 years + Underwriting experience with commercial Motor products.
